Explain how John Brown's raid affected the slavery debate.

Respuesta :

HistoryGuy HistoryGuy
  • 08-09-2015
John Brown's raid infuriated many slave owners who were worried that it would influence slave revolts, while it solidified the anti-slavery movement in the North because of its abject failure.
